Title
Letter from Lord Hardinge to Queen Victoria
Date
6 December 1852
Writer
Hardinge, Henry, 1st Viscount
Addressee
Victoria, Queen
Description
The appointment of General Procter places £200 per annum at Queen Victoria's service as Good Service Money. Lord Hardinge makes recommendations as to the disposal of part of this, namely, £100 a year to Major General James Campbell.
